Takeaways:

  • As Agile practitioners, we need to continue to evolve
  • Kanban is a promising tool for sharing Lean benefits outside teams
  • Pick the right tools for the job! Kanban and Scrum have their advantages, start with your problem and then pick the right tool
  • David shared my experiences with Kanban teams demonstrating a "white box" behaviour instead of a "black box" (not your business) towards its stakeholders
  • Classes of Service is a hot upcoming topic around Risk Management
  • In Japan the "why" is the most important thing. Therefore rigorous effort is spent on understanding Values and Princinples, compared to our Western approach of staring with the Practices (therefore not being able to adopt when situation change)
